Ronald Reagan Washington National Airport (called Reagan National Airport in The Conduit) is a location in The Conduit. Like many locations in The Conduit, Reagan National Airport is based off of the real life location located in Washington D.C.. This location appears in Contagion of The Conduit's Campaign and hosts as the introduction to three enemy characters, Puppet Humans, Trust Scientists & Trust Field Agents. The airport is also connected to the subway system which allows an option of transportation. During the events of The Conduit, the subway line connected to Reagan National Airport, is used to transport the ASE to a safer location, however the process is interrupted unintentionally by Michael Ford under John Adams guidance in an attempt to recapture the "stolen" prototype device.
